Brussels, 10/07/2018, in special representation: Λ ΒΕ2017 / 0062 1. description A positioning device for mounting transformers and the method for using them Technical field The present invention relates to the field of plant construction, in particular a positioning device for attaching transformers and the method for their use. Technical background In systems such as workshops, electrical devices such as transformers are usually housed in boxes and are easier to maintain and maintain. When installing the transformers in such boxes, crane systems and elastic steel cables are used due to the relatively high weight. There is always a need to position the transformers safely and precisely when they are lowered in the intended place in the box. Since the transformer is usually heavy, this is often very difficult and there is a risk of accidents in which personnel could be injured and machinery could be damaged. Content of the invention The present invention is therefore based on the object of specifying a positioning device for attaching transformers and the method for using them, in which the disadvantages in the prior art have been eliminated. As for the device of the present invention, this is solved by the following technical concept: The invention Positioning device is intended to bend and dock an electrical transformer when it is mounted in a box, the cross-section of which is square, at the intended location. It includes a guide set, a positioning system, which is firmly connected to the transformer via a fastening element. The guide set includes four guide rods attached to the four Corner plates are attached, which are provided in the corners of the box. Each guide rod has a swivel arm, which is connected to the respective corner plate via a hinge, and a hook section, which is bent upwards and outwards, depending on the height, and the angle to the swivel arm is less than 90 °. The positioning system comprises a square and frame-shaped roller carrier which rotatably carries a contact roller on each side. Furthermore, the positioning system has a main plate which is surrounded by the roller carrier and is firmly connected to it. The upper side of the main plate is connected to the rope of the crane system and the lower side of the main plate is connected to the transformer via a fastening element. The upper ends of the hook sections each point into the upper corners of the box. The contact rollers are designed to come into contact with the hook sections when the transformer is lowered. Each touch roller includes a rotatable outer tube that can roll on the hook portion. Furthermore, each contact roller has an inner tube which is not rotatable but can slide on the slide rail of the roller carrier in the axial direction. The inner tube is connected on both sides with adjustment bolts, which are each connected to an adjustment spring. The adjustment springs are housed in the cavity of the respective side of the roller holder. Therefore, each contact roller can slide in the axial direction on its side of the roller holder. The interplay of hook sections and contact rollers allows the transformer to be safely and precisely towed and docked to the intended location in the box when it is lowered. A metal sensor is provided in the middle of the bottom of the box. There is a metal sheet in the middle of the lower side of the transformer. When the metal sheet has reached the right place, it is detected by the metal sensor and the LED indicator lights up and signals that the transformer is docked in the right place on the rear wall of the A ventilation duct is provided in the box, in which a cooling valve is attached, which ventilates the operating heat in the box in good time so that the transformer can work stably and safely. The method for using the positioning device according to the invention proceeds as follows: In the initial phase, the guide rods are in the folded-up state. If, when the transformer is lowered, it reaches a height level that is lower than the corner plates, the BE2017 / 0062 Positioning system are still above the covered level of the corner plates, the swivel arms are swung out in the horizontal direction. When the transformer is lowered further, the first contact roller will come into contact with the hook section corresponding to its side, with the slight oscillating movement of the transformer. In the further process, all other contact rollers will also come into contact with the respective hook sections. The interaction of the contact rollers and hook sections absorbs the swinging of the transformer during lowering and enables smooth guidance to the intended location.As each contact roller can also slide in the axial direction on the roller carrier, the first contact point between the respective hook section and the contact roller must also not exactly the center of the touch roller. The contact point is automatically adjusted and centered by the counteraction of the next adjacent contact roller and with the help of the adjustment springs and adjustment bolts.
